J. D. Durbin debuted on September 8, 2004 and played his final game on September 20, 2007.
J. D. Durbin was born February 24, 1982, in Portland, OR, USA.
J. D. Durbin is 6 feet tall. He weighs 210 pounds. He bats right and throws right.
J. D. Durbin debuted on September 8, 2004, playing for the Minnesota Twins at Hubert H Humphrey Metrodome; he played his final game on September 20, 2007, playing for the Philadelphia Phillies at Citizens Bank Park.

In 2007, J. D. Durbin played in 18 games, batting in all of them. He had 19 at bats, getting 5 hits, for a .263 batting average, with 3 sacrifice hits, 0 sacrifice flies, and 0 runs batted in. He was walked 0 times. He struck out 5 times. He hit 1 doubles, 0 triples, and 0 home runs.
J. D. Durbin played in 4 games at pitcher for the Minnesota Twins in 2004, starting in 1 of them. He played for a total of 22 outs, equivalent to .81 9-inning games. He made no putouts, had 2 assists, and committed no errors, equivalent to 0 errors per 9-inning game. He had no double plays.
J. D. Durbin played in just one game at pitcher for the Arizona Diamondbacks in 2007 and did not start. He played for a total of 2 outs, equivalent to .07 9-inning games. He made one putout, had no assists, and committed no errors, equivalent to 0 errors per 9-inning game. He had no double plays.
